The Role:

  • To manage and oversee the delivery of electrical installations, responsive repairs and planned works which includes but is not limited to inspection & testing, complete electrical works, heating installations and full property rewires.
  • Striving to achieve first time fix and remain within budget constraints.
  • To act as a Qualified Supervisor (QS) maintaining high standards required to review and sign off electrical certification.
  • To update relevant stakeholders of works progress and action taken.
  • In more complex cases to escalate to management to identify the necessary remedial action.
  • To ensure that the results of inspection and testing are recorded correctly on the appropriate certificates or reports.
  • To validate, compile and sign off reports and certification, ensuring corrective and preventative action is taken where required.
  • To complete and maintain records accurately in accordance with company policies and procedures following the industry standards and requirements, safeguarding all certification, and reporting any loss, theft, or misuse appropriately.
  • Ensuring that all relevant items and records are available for inspection when required by NICEIC.
  • To set out jobs from drawings and specifications to establish the requirements of the project and requisition the necessary installation materials and ensure compliance and test systems.
  • To comply with health and safety legislation, policies, and procedures in accordance with BS7671 ‘the performance of the duties of the post’.
  • To own the prompt resolution of customer feedback including complaints within area of responsibility to ensure a high level of customer satisfaction is maintained liaising with appropriate colleagues and customers.
  • To optimise trade-staff to meet service requirements across the operating area, ensuring the balance, efficiency and effectiveness of the team is regularly reviewed against productivity targets and performance results.
  • To undertake daily monitoring of your area performance, undertaking reviews and collating reports on progress & taking action of any variance from expected standards.
  • To proactively support the growth and development of all team members throughout Safer Homes.
  • To participate in the out of hours service as a guide to the trades and link to the OOH call centre and escalation paths as required.
  • Provide support to and deputise for the Senior Electrical Operations Manager in their absence, as required.
  • To undertake any other tasks commensurate to the role.

The Candidate will need to be:

  • Demonstrates supervisory/managerial skills within electrical works or worked within a similar role previously.
  • Hold or previously held a “Qualified Supervisors” position with a recognised certificating body (E.g., NICEIC or Napit).
  • Previously a registered apprentice or undergone some equivalent method training and have had adequate practical training in electrical installation work.
  • Achievement Measurement 2 (AM2) and a qualified Electrician with relevant experience in social housing.
  • Qualifications to include City & Guilds 2391, City & Guilds 2360 Parts 1 and 2 or 2351 or 2330 levels 2 and 3 or approved equivalent or NVQ level 3 in Electrical Installation Work or approved equivalent.
  • Have achieved their City & Guilds 2394 or 2395 in initial verification, certification, periodic inspection & testing of electrical installations or approved equivalent.
  • Demonstrates practical knowledge and competence working as an electrician in the current edition of BS:7671 and inspection, testing and commissioning of installations.
  • Full Driving licence and ability to travel with use of own vehicle in a timely and efficient manner to attend customers properties, frequently located in areas not covered by public transport.
  • Highly motivated and enthusiastic individual, with the ability to work under pressure and prioritise workloads without compromising on customer service.
